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ll send our technicians to assess the damage and create a customized plan to restore your property. This step is crucial in determining the extent of the damage and identifying potential safety hazards.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ify areas that need attention. We’ll work with you to focus on the most critical areas and develop a plan to tackle them first.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Our team will use advanced equipment to extract water quickly and efficiently, reducing the risk of further damage and costly repairs. We’ll use a combination of pumps, vacuums, and other specialized equipment to remove standing water and saturated materials.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and reducing the risk of secondary dam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our team will focus on drying and dehumidifying the affected areas. We’ll use specialized equipment to remove excess moisture and humidity, creating a safe and healthy environment for you and your family. This step is essential in preventing mold growth and reducing the risk of further damage.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ize the affected areas to prevent the growth of bacteria, mold, and other microorganisms. We’ll use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to remove dirt, grime, and other contaminants. This step is crucial in creating a safe and healthy environment for you and your family.
Step 5: Repair and Reconstruction
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will focus on repairing and reconstructing the affected areas. We’ll work with you to find out the best course of action and provide recommendations for any necessary repairs. Our team will use high-quality materials and equipment to ensure a durable and long-lasting repair.

Warning Signs You Need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ration in Bixby, OK
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. If you notice any of the following signs,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age. Our team is here to help you identify the issue and provide a solution.
Mold Growth
Black or greenish mold growth on walls, ceilings, or floors is a clear indication of water damage. If left unchecked, mold can spread quickly, causing health hazards and further damage. Our team will use specialized equipment to remove mold and prevent future growth.
Musty Odors
Strong musty odors can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your property, it’s essential to investigate further.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ify potential safety hazards.
Water Stains
Water stains on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of water damage or leaks. If left unchecked, water stains can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ify potential safety hazards.
Warped or Buckled Floors
Warped or buckled floors can be a sign of water damage or structural issues. If left unchecked, these problems can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ify potential safety hazards.
Discoloration
Disc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. If left unchecked, discoloration can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ify potential safety hazards.

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Cost in Bixby, OK
The cost of multi-family water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Bixby, OK. Our team will provide a free estimate and work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process and reduce your out-of-pocket expenses.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water present. |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age. |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ning required. |
| Repair and re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ials required for repair. |
| Mold remediation |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the severity of the mold growth. |
| Structural repairs | $5,000 – $20,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ials required for repair. |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ates for all our services.
